Started skating on the ice rink near his house. He began short track skating when he started elementary school, and two years later doing speed skating as well. Combined the two until his first year of middle school, before concentrating on speed skating only. (naeil.com, 14 Feb 2018)

:

After his bronze medal in the 1500m at the PyeongChang 2018 Olympic Winter Games, he said, "I will try to do better at the 2022 Beijing Games." (naeil.com, 14 Feb 2018)
